Output 28315a9ddb497616f6b94d5701eea78c5c23cb8f09e0b1ff00273d66c5930f39:3

value
27448639
script pubkey
OP_0 OP_PUSHBYTES_20 23770643df5e9000f3167a3d8c74be4600f275b6
address
bc1qydmsvs7lt6gqpuck0g7cca97gcq0yadkngh2ug
transaction
28315a9ddb497616f6b94d5701eea78c5c23cb8f09e0b1ff00273d66c5930f39